Hanna Joins Infinova's Technical Support Staff

Infinova recently announced that Jeff Hanna has joined the technical support staff at the company's headquarters in the United States. Hanna is the latest hire to this key group that provides technical support for integrators in the Americas, Europe, Middle East, Africa and India.

“We’re dedicated to being known as 'the integrator’s manufacturer,' stressed Mark S. Wilson, Infinova vice president, marketing. “As such, we need talented individuals, such as Hanna, who can help our integrators gain more sales more easily. Sometimes, that’s as simple as expediting an order while, other times, it may be working with engineering to customize something that the surveillance customer needs to make their system perform.”

Most recently, Hanna has been in electronic sales and support. He has a bachelor's degree in electrical and computer engineering from Rowan University.

    Snap One has announced its popular Luma x20 family of surveillance products now offers even greater security and privacy for home and business owners across the globe by giving them full control over integrators’ system access to view live and recorded video. According to Snap One Product Manager Derek Webb, the new “customer handoff” feature provides enhanced user control after initial installation, allowing the owners to have total privacy while also making it easy to reinstate integrator access when maintenance or assistance is required. This new feature is now available to all Luma x20 users globally. “The Luma x20 family of surveillance solutions provides excellent image and audio capture, and with the new customer handoff feature, it now offers absolute privacy for camera feeds and recordings,” Webb said. “With notifications and integrator access controlled through the powerful OvrC remote system management platform, it’s easy for integrators to give their clients full control of their footage and then to get temporary access from the client for any troubleshooting needs.”
